The Civic Music Association of Des Moines has announced it’s 2020-21 season. Jazz highlights include a concert with Jazz at Lincoln Center lead trumpeter Sean Jones, and tributes to Ray Charles (featuring Take 6), as well as Bessie Smith, Billie Holiday, and Nina Simone. Family Folk Machine, Iowa City’s intergenerational folk choir, is rescheduling their spring concert for fall. And while they are unable to meet in person, have hosted a “virtual open mic” for their members, continue to hold their songwriting classes, and more.
